![]() Susana N. says :
Jan 13, 2009
It depends on a bunch of variables. if it's the south, then from May to October you can go to the beach and have a swim. The further you go up north the more you have to go during summer, meaning July-august, but most probably the water might be cold. Personally, I find the best time to be september, less crowded, often nicer weather than in August (when it can rain a lot), and beaches from central to south portugal will be just fine.
